Spoke or Speaked
Understand why “Spoke” is correct and “Speaked” is incorrect.
Speaked
Incorrect spelling - “Speaked” is incorrect verb form.
"Speaked" is a common misspelling of "Spoke". Always use "Spoke" when referring to the correct word.
Spoke
Correct spelling - The proper way to spell this word.
“Spoke” is the correct past tense of speak.

Usage Examples
"Correct:" He spoke to them.
"Correct:" She spoke clearly.
"Correct:" They spoke earlier.
"Correct:" I spoke with him.
"Incorrect:" He speaked to them.
"Incorrect:" She speaked clearly.
"Incorrect:" They speaked.
"Incorrect:" I speaked with him.
Notes:
- • Irregular verb rule.
- • speak → spoke.
- • Don’t use ‘-ed’.
